我想通过 SSH 连接我的 ec2。
但我收到这个错误:
@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
@ WARNING: UNPROTECTED PRIVATE KEY FILE! @
@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
Permissions for 'F:\\Config\\first1.pem' are too open.
It is required that your private key files are NOT accessible by others.
This private key will be ignored.
Load key "F:\\Config\\first1.pem": bad permissions
[email protected] /cdn-cgi/l/email-protection: Permission denied (publickey).
我如何在 Windows 上解决这个问题?
这是对我有用的方法
Step 1
右键单击密钥文件first1.pem
在资源管理器上并转到属性 > 安全 > 高级 > 禁用继承
Step 2
Select “将继承的权限转换为该对象的显式权限”
Step 3
然后删除那里的所有内容(包括管理员、用户、用户组)
并单击Add button.
Step 4
现在选择选择主体 > 高级 > 立即查找 > [您的用户对象] > 确定
Step 5
现在您可以勾选“完全控制“然后按OK
现在其他人无法访问您的密钥文件。这是唯一对我有用的方法。希望能帮助到你。谢谢。
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)